問題を解決する:209
クラウド・コンピューティングとは、ネットワーク・ベースのコンピューティング・モデルであり、その中核となる考え方は、ネットワーク接続を介してユーザーにコンピューティング・リソースとサービスを提供することである。クラウド・コンピューティングの基本概念には、次のようなものがある。リソースの共有:クラウド・コンピューティングのリソースを複数のユーザーで共有できるため、リソースの利用率が高くなる。弾力的なスケーリング:クラウド・コンピューティング・システムは、さまざまな規模のアプリケーションのニーズを満たすため、需要に応じてリソースの数や構成を自動的に調整できる。サービス化:クラウド・コンピューティング・リソースはサービスの形でユーザーに提供され、ユーザーは特定の実装の詳細にこだわることなく、要求に応じて関連サービスを購入するだけでよい。仮想化:クラウド・コンピューティング・リソースは、論理的な分離と物理リソースの柔軟な割り当てを実現するために、仮想化技術によって編成・管理される。仮想化技術:物理リソース(サーバー、ストレージデバイス、ネットワークなど)を仮想化技術によって複数の仮想リソースに分割し、リソースの分離、共有、管理を実現する。管理の自動化:自動化された管理ツールにより、クラウド・コンピューティング・リソースの自動展開、監視、メンテナンス、スケジューリングを実現し、リソースの利用効率と信頼性を向上させる。分散アーキテクチャ:クラウドコンピューティングシステムは通常、分散アーキテクチャを採用し、システムのスケーラビリティとフォールトトレランスを向上させるために、コンピューティングとストレージのタスクを複数のノードに分散して処理します。ネットワーク技術:クラウド・コンピューティングは、リソースへのアクセスと管理を実現するためにネットワーク技術に依存しているため、高速で安定したセキュアなネットワーク・インフラストラクチャによってサポートされる必要があります。